What is a clarifying treatment at a salon?

Professional in-salon treatment used to clarify and help remove excess product build-up from product or copper and iron deposits on hair. It also equalizes porosity prior to chemical services.

How long does a clarifying treatment take?

Leave on 5 to 20 minutes depending on amount of buildup in the hair. Leave on only 1 to 2 minutes if following a chemical service. Shampoo and rinse after processing, then proceed with chemical service if desired. Use before color services for better color results.

What is clarifying shampoo made of?

Like other types of hair cleansers, clarifying shampoo is made up of between 80 and 90 percent water. The difference is in the active ingredients. What sets clarifying shampoo apart from other cleansers is its level of heavy surfactants. Surfactants are soap-like ingredients that get rid of residue, grease, and impurities in your hair.

What is the difference between clarifying shampoo and hair detox?

A clarifying shampoo has virtually the same goals as a hair detox. They both remove residue, minerals, and oils. The key difference lies in the active ingredients. Hair detox relies primarily on “natural” ingredients, while clarifying shampoos have more synthetic ingredients that can dry out your hair ...

What is clarifying shampoo?

Simply put, a clarifying shampoo is designed to remove build-up on your hair. Stuff—all kinds of it—builds up on your hair: hairsprays, mousses, and gels; minerals in hard water; chlorine and chemicals from swimming pools. Even the waxes and moisturizers in some shampoos and conditioners can leave residue on your hair over time.

What to use to remove light film from hair?

Using a clarifying shampoo is a good idea if you live in an area with hard water. Hard water contains a buildup of minerals such as calcium and magnesium, which can leave a light film on your strands after every wash. A good clarifying or detoxifying formula will help lift the light film away.
